Prime Video's upcoming R-rated romantic drama "The Idea of You," starring Anne Hathaway and Nicholas Galitzine, is set to premiere on May 2. Inspired by the bestselling novel by Robinne Lee, the film explores themes of love, age, and societal expectations as it follows the journey of a 40-year-old single mother and her romance with a young rock star. The story promises to captivate audiences with its portrayal of love and self-discovery amidst media scrutiny.

Kevin Bacon, 65, and Kyra Sedgwick, 58, are set to co-star in the romantic drama Connescence, marking their first on-screen collaboration in 20 years. Bacon will play a witty but underachieving security guard who meets Sedgwick's character after foiling a robbery at her home, leading to a friendship that evolves into something more. The couple, who first met on the set of 1988's Lemon Sky and married in 1988, expressed excitement about working together again and will also serve as producers on the film, which has already begun production in Brooklyn, New York.
